MertenIs Water Monitor Lizard
Merten's Water Monitor Lizard (Varanus mertensi ). Manning Gorge, Kimberleys, Western Australia. Found along small streams and creeks in tropical northern Australia. Often seen sunning on exposed rocks. Superb swimmer, eating fish, frogs, shrimps and crabs in the Wet Season. Can hold breath for several minutes. In the Dry Season when streams become pools or dry up completely they eat insects, birds eggs, spiders ants, small mammals and carrion. Lay 10-14 eggs in burrows 50cm deep. Eggs hatch from 182-316 days depending on the temperature
